The energy efficiency of a double-glazed window is dependent on the type of repairing glass frames, the frame materials, and the installation method. The British Fenestration Rating Council, or BFRC determines the energy efficiency by coding it from++ to "E". It also takes into account the thickness of the window, the sealing of the gaps, as well as the gas used. It is recommended that you search for a company that offers windows that are rated C or higher which will guarantee that you will save money on heating costs.

uPVC is the most common material used to make double-glazing frames. In comparison to traditional timber sash windows repair uPVC is more environmentally friendly and does not require frequent maintenance. It is also recyclable and can be reused over 10 times with no loss of quality. It is strong and has an improved finish that guarantees the durability of your window.

In addition to being more affordable, uPVC windows are also more secure than timber. They are more difficult to break in because they have a stronger locking mechanism and a deadbolt that is built-in. In addition, they are simpler to clean and maintain. Additionally, they have a low moisture content, which prevents condensation.

It is important to verify the accreditations after you've found an installer who is reputable. These accreditations can give you peace-of-mind that the installation is being carried out in the most professional manner. FENSA, for example, is a scheme that is approved by the government that monitors compliance with building regulations for replacement windows. TrustMark is another important accreditation that confirms a business's technical competence and business practices.
